We compared two Professional market GPUs: 512MB VRAM Quadro 400 and 16GB VRAM Quadro P5000 to see which GPU has better performance in key specifications, benchmark tests, power consumption, etc.
Main Differences
NVIDIA Quadro 400 's Advantages
Lower TDP (32W vs 180W)
NVIDIA Quadro P5000 's Advantages
Released 5 years and 6 months late
Boost Clock1733MHz
Larger VRAM bandwidth (288.5GB/s vs 12.32GB/s)
2512 additional rendering cores
